What are motels like?
At many motels, you’ll often find a free parking spot and an outdoor pool. When you stay at a motel property, you’ll usually access your room directly from the parking lot. The word “motel” was coined in 1925 by the owner of the Milestone Mo-Tel in San Luis Obispo, California.

What's the weather like in Leclercville?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so here’s some data about year-round temperatures in Leclercville to help you plan yours: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 62°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 18°F. Average annual precipitation for Leclercville is 57 inches.
